The Evolution of Neon Sign Making
Neon signs have a rich history that dates back to the early 20th century. Originally, these signs were handcrafted by skilled artisans who bent glass tubes and filled them with gas. However, as technology advanced, so too did the methods of production. The introduction of industrial robotics has revolutionized the way neon signs are manufactured, making the process faster, more accurate, and less labor-intensive.
From Handcrafted to Automated
In the early days, creating a neon sign was a labor-intensive process that required extensive training and experience. Artisans would meticulously bend glass tubes into intricate shapes, a skill that took years to master. While this traditional method is still valued for its craftsmanship, the rise of automated processes has allowed for greater scalability and consistency in production.
Modern neon sign making equipment incorporates advanced technology, including CNC machines and robotic arms, which can replicate complex designs with remarkable precision. This shift not only enhances production speed but also reduces the risk of human error, ensuring that each sign meets the desired specifications.

Glass Bending Machines
Glass bending machines are at the heart of neon sign production. These machines are designed to heat glass tubes to a pliable state, allowing them to be bent into the desired shapes. Modern machines often come equipped with programmable controls that enable operators to input specific design parameters, ensuring precision in every bend.
The technology behind glass bending has advanced significantly, with some machines using infrared heating elements for faster and more uniform heating. This innovation not only speeds up the production process but also minimizes the risk of damaging the glass, resulting in higher-quality products.
Gas Filling Equipment
Once the glass tubes are shaped, they need to be filled with gas to create the iconic neon glow. Gas filling equipment is crucial in this stage of production. The most common gases used are neon and argon, often combined with phosphor coatings to produce a variety of colors.
Modern gas filling systems are designed to be efficient and safe, incorporating features such as vacuum pumps and pressure regulators. These systems ensure that the glass tubes are filled accurately and that the gases are contained safely, reducing the risk of leaks or accidents during production.
